


「com.mysql.jdbc.exceptions.jdbc4.CommunicationsException:通訊鏈路故障」解釋
嘗試連接到 MySQL資料庫時,你可能會遇到神秘的錯誤「com.mysql.jdbc.exceptions.jdbc4.CommunicationsException: Communications link 失敗。」雖然此異常本身不太清晰,但對堆疊追蹤的徹底檢查通常會揭示根本原因。
通常,此錯誤是一個包裝的異常,掩蓋了更多資訊的異常,例如「SQLException:連接被拒絕」或「SQLException:連接逾時。」這些異常指向幾個潛在原因:
可能的原因
- JDBC URL 中的IP位址或主機名稱不正確
- 由於以下原因導致無法辨識的主機名稱DNS 問題
- 連接埠缺失或錯誤數量
- 不活動的資料庫伺服器
- 伺服器上已停用的TCP/IP連接
- 防火牆或代理的外部阻止
故障排除步驟
要解決此問題,請仔細遵循以下步驟步驟:
- 驗證網路連線:使用ping確認是否可以從您的系統存取 IP 位址或主機名稱。
- 檢查 DNS 配置: 使用 ping 測試主機名稱並考慮直接在 JDBC 中使用 IP 位址URL。
- 確認資料庫可用性:確保資料庫伺服器正在運作並接受 TCP/IP 連線。
- 檢查 MySQL 設定:驗證MySQL 伺服器未使用「--skip-networking」選項運作。
- 停用防火牆和代理:暫時停用或重新配置這些功能以允許資料庫連接埠上的連線。
其他注意事項
- 避免不必要的資料庫透過在系統期間僅載入一次JDBC 驅動程式來建立連線
透過執行這些故障排除步驟,您可以找出此異常的根本原因,並與您的MySQL 資料庫建立穩定的連線。請記住查閱堆疊追蹤以獲取可能提供進一步見解的更具體的錯誤訊息。
以上是為什麼連接 MySQL 時出現「com.mysql.jdbc.exceptions.jdbc4.CommunicationsException: Communications link failure」?的詳細內容。更多資訊請關注PHP中文網其他相關文章!

本文討論了使用MySQL的Alter Table語句修改表,包括添加/刪除列,重命名表/列以及更改列數據類型。

文章討論了為MySQL配置SSL/TLS加密,包括證書生成和驗證。主要問題是使用自簽名證書的安全含義。[角色計數:159]

文章討論了流行的MySQL GUI工具,例如MySQL Workbench和PhpMyAdmin,比較了它們對初學者和高級用戶的功能和適合性。[159個字符]

本文討論了使用Drop Table語句在MySQL中放下表,並強調了預防措施和風險。它強調,沒有備份,該動作是不可逆轉的,詳細介紹了恢復方法和潛在的生產環境危害。

本文討論了在PostgreSQL,MySQL和MongoDB等各個數據庫中的JSON列上創建索引,以增強查詢性能。它解釋了索引特定的JSON路徑的語法和好處,並列出了支持的數據庫系統。

文章討論了使用準備好的語句,輸入驗證和強密碼策略確保針對SQL注入和蠻力攻擊的MySQL。(159個字符)


熱AI工具

Undresser.AI Undress
人工智慧驅動的應用程序,用於創建逼真的裸體照片

AI Clothes Remover
用於從照片中去除衣服的線上人工智慧工具。

Undress AI Tool
免費脫衣圖片

Clothoff.io
AI脫衣器

AI Hentai Generator
免費產生 AI 無盡。

熱門文章

熱工具

SublimeText3漢化版
中文版,非常好用

MinGW - Minimalist GNU for Windows
這個專案正在遷移到osdn.net/projects/mingw的過程中,你可以繼續在那裡關注我們。 MinGW:GNU編譯器集合(GCC)的本機Windows移植版本,可自由分發的導入函式庫和用於建置本機Windows應用程式的頭檔;包括對MSVC執行時間的擴展,以支援C99功能。 MinGW的所有軟體都可以在64位元Windows平台上運作。

Atom編輯器mac版下載
最受歡迎的的開源編輯器

記事本++7.3.1
好用且免費的程式碼編輯器

mPDF
mPDF是一個PHP庫,可以從UTF-8編碼的HTML產生PDF檔案。原作者Ian Back編寫mPDF以從他的網站上「即時」輸出PDF文件,並處理不同的語言。與原始腳本如HTML2FPDF相比,它的速度較慢,並且在使用Unicode字體時產生的檔案較大,但支援CSS樣式等,並進行了大量增強。支援幾乎所有語言,包括RTL(阿拉伯語和希伯來語)和CJK(中日韓)。支援嵌套的區塊級元素(如P、DIV),